你查询的IP:[117.22.111.126]  地理位置:中国–陕西–西安

最新查询202.70.243.155 60.194.193.139 125.169.245.65 218.208.145.98 120.52.158.211 159.226.157.23 222.248.14.222 125.216.194.49 121.255.245.98 117.22.111.126 203.80.144.238 122.156.228.32 118.80.36.129 125.96.43.37 202.90.252.160 119.18.224.220 202.130.65.92 58.32.167.19 118.212.11.136 61.232.232.143 219.224.88.179 119.162.222.251 59.155.78.169 221.133.224.190 222.248.17.197 121.52.224.212 116.193.16.88 203.79.62.88 117.121.192.92 202.131.48.28 119.59.128.174